I've got a Dearborn 2 btm 3 pt plow that was often run behind the Ford 8Ns and such. Well I don't have the N anymore but still would like to use this plow behind my now larger CAT 2 hitch tractor BUT the pin on one side of the plow is too short and has since been cutoff. My question is how is that 3pt pin attached? The other side pin just bolts right on through the 1" thick cross piece but this side was either threaded into the crosspiece or maybe swedged in? If I can get the stub out I can figure out a way to replace it with a longer pin - and perhaps a CAT2 or at least bush it.
